Appointed

June 9, 2025

B.P. Shivakumar has been appointed as the Manager (in-Charge) of The Mysore Merchants Co-operative Bank Ltd., Mysuru, at the Bank’s Executive Board Meeting held on May 31.

MCCI Managing Committee meeting

June 9, 2025

The Managing Committee Meeting of Mysore Chamber of Commerce and Industry (MCCI) will be held at the Cosmopolitan Club, Dr. S. Radhakrishna Avenue, Chamarajapuram, Mysuru, on June 11 at 7 pm, according to a press release from MCCI President K.B. Lingaraju and Hon. Secretary  A.K. Shivaji Rao.

Staging of play on June 7, 8

June 7, 2025

Rangavalli Theatre Troupe will be staging comedy play ‘Parameshi Prema Prasanga’ at Mini Theatre in Kalamandira premises today and tomorrow (June 7 and 8) at 6.30 pm. The play, written by Srinivasaprabhu, is directed by Ravi Prasad. Tickets are priced at Rs. 100.
